TAK Broadband is a leading end-to-end U.S. fiber broadband network construction contractor operating in 42 states. It builds more than just networks; it connects communities to new valuable digital opportunities. TAK offers comprehensive service solutions, from construction to drops to fulfillment. TAK’s ecosystem of partners allows it to successfully complete every project starting from the first point of conception. This includes engineering teams, distributors, and more than 100 qualified construction crews with extensive experience across all ISP types and markets; over 300 experienced bury drop crews; and more than 700 professional technicians.


We are seeking a Construction Supervisor to join our team in the Plover, WI area. In this role you will support all phases of construction projects and manage all aspects of the day-to-day operations of team members.

The Role

  • Hire, train and develop talent for all roles
  • Support all phases of construction projects
  • Travel throughout market to various projects as needed
  • Develop skillsets and knowledge of construction teams – both aerial and underground
  • Manage payroll and overtime guidelines; manage productivity levels
  • Complete employee performance management functions; disciplinary actions, performance reviews and ongoing development
  • Will be the team’s “expert” and “go to” resource; spending time in the field to understand, improve and build out the team
  • Review, update and maintain team data
  • Manage all aspects of the day-to-day operations of team members; headcount requirements
  • Work with leaders to delegate tasks when relevant
  • Keep safety as #1 priority for each team member: adhering to company safety standards and all federal, state and local laws
  • Drive team to meet deadlines and produce quality projects
  • Provide a high level of customer service when interfacing with customers
  • Provide direction to multiple crews and their job site activities
  • Build and maintain positive relationships with utilities, clients, permitting agencies and government officials as needed
  • Handle customer and contractor problems related to projects
  • Work in a variety of environments; indoors, outdoors, elevated, tight spaces etc.
  • Maintain open communications with other departments
  • Other duties as assigned

Requirements

  • 3 years of relevant aerial and/or underground telecommunications construction experience required
  • Prior project leadership experience preferred
  • Prior construction industry experience required; coax splicing, fiber splicing, directional drilling, map reading, etc.
  • Ability to be flexible and manage changing priorities
  • Able to travel throughout market to various projects as needed
  • Open to a variety of schedules and accessible outside of normal business hours as needed
  • Excellent customer service, time management, problem-solving and troubleshooting skills
  • Ability to communicate effectively in-person or virtually
  • Ability to build and maintain positive relationships with internal and external customers
  • Ability to give feedback; positive and negative when needed
  • Strong desire to grow and develop team members
  • Ability to complete work indoors, outdoors, in tight spaces and elevated by bending, reaching, twisting, climbing as needed
  • Ability to safely navigate various terrains, managing equipment and tools
  • A body weight of no more than 275 pounds to perform ladder work safely. **Safety is our #1 Priority. If personal safety is not compromised, an accommodation may be available based on previous ladder experience in a similar role**
  • Must provide a valid government-issued photo ID for verification; a driver’s license is required if the role involves driving
  • Passing of all pre-employment requirements (MVR, Background Check, Drug Screen)
